About this House

Vacant land located in the historic Springfield District.
445 E 7th St, Jacksonville, FL 32206 is a 1,512 sqft lot/land in Springfield, built in 1914. It last sold for $5,000 on Dec 30, 2013. It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ate rent is $1,451/month.

  • Krstngrant
    "A good mix of people which is great! Lots of dog walking and pedestrian friendly. People look out for one another and the neighborhood gets better everyday."
  • Richardcstein
    "The sidewalks are wide and there are also parks and green spaces in the neighborhood. A lot of residents are dog owners. "
  • Melraemorgan
    "Porchfest! Second Sundays in the park, the annual Baseball game, First Fridays, Pride, Eastside Market, Tour of Homes. But the people and friendships I have made here are the best things about this neighborhood."
  • Trulia User
    "Friendly neighbors, neighborhood gathering like nowhere else in town. You might encounter some vagrants, but they usually keep to themselves. Might be intimidating to some. Need to have an open mind, not racist or homophobic. There's always a neighbor ready to help, even if you don't know them. "
  • Gynger F.
    "It’s very easy to get around in this neighborhood . The bus route It’s on the main thorough fare in the bus station is very close because the neighborhood is near downtown."
  • Jim S.
    "It is its own community. People know and care for each other and about Springfield. Neighbors are friends. "
  • Mandree11
    "best neighborhood! feels like a village. I love the way we get together for events, clean ups, parties... I lived in Riverside, Murray Hill... not the same neighborhood feel."
  • Rmarie9
    "I love living here. The friendly people and real community feel are what really set it apart from any neighborhood I’ve ever lived in in Jacksonville. People I didn’t even know let us borrow decorations, patio heaters, even a golf cart for our wedding in Klutho Park last winter. I’m so glad it is starting to draw younger families, cool events, and more businesses to the area."
  • John B.
    "Most dogs in the neighborhood are on a leash while walking in the neighborhood but their owners dont always pick up after their furry family members."
  • Mitchell
    "This is by far the best neighborhood I have lived in in Florida. Everyone has a sense of pride and it truly reminds me of growing up in suburban NY. "
  • Rich S.
    "I have a car so I’m not sure about public transportation but I do see the buses drive through the neighborhood. There’s a decent amount of restaurants and little stores in the neighborhood and it’s very close to downtown. I see a lot of people riding bicycles as well. "
  • Mandree11
    "Springfield is an up and coming area where the sense of community and family is strong. Most families send their kids to magnet schools (choice school). "
  • Javherrera65
    "Porch fest yearly festival Second Sunday arts and music events July fourth vintage baseball event Thanksgiving morning turkey bowl flag football All events in Kluth park"
  • Joseph R.
    "I see people walking their dogs all the time. It is very dog friendly here. All kinds of breeds. They are leashed and you must pick up after them. "
  • Kelley B.
    "I've lived in the neighborhood off and on for over 20 years. I've seen it come up over the years, thus is the best I've seen it yet. It's family friendly now and very nice."
  • Valorie F.
    "Fun to be involved with all of the community happenings. LOTS of great folks live in the area and I truly miss living there."
  • K T.
    "Most family friendly and culturally diverse neighborhood in Jacksonville."
